Kimberly starts a presentation on child safety by sharing that "more than 200 million children today are child laborers, and 73

million of these children are below 10 years. Can we do anything about these numbers?" This makes the audience attentive and responsive throughout the presentation. In the given scenario, which of the following types of hooks does Kimberly use to open her presentation?
A. A simile
B. An engaging question
C. An anecdote
D. A startling statistic
Social Studies
1 answer:
GuDViN [60]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

The best answer seems to be letter B. an engaging question.

Explanation:

Even though Kimberly did use some startling statistics about child labor, it is her question that engages the audience. Rhetorical questions are a tool to get your audience thinking when you are giving a speech. The audience will begin to ponder what you have asked about, trying to find a solution for it. Therefore, they will pay close attention to what you have to say on that matter, to how you answer your own question.

Which of the following statements about marriage is true? Group of answer choices Marriage occurs in every culture and is found
Hoochie [10]

Answer:

Marriage occurs in every culture in some form, but its exact characteristics vary widely

Explanation:

Marriage is a term that describes the culturally and socially accepted union of two or more individuals. It is widely considered as an established method of legislating sexual intercourse by specifying sexual partners.

However, there are different forms of marriage across various cultures in the world, such as Monogamy; same-sex marriage, serial monogamy., Polygamy; polygyny, polyandry., Group marriage, fixed-term marriage, sororate, ghost marriage, levirate, etc.

Hence, the statement that is true about marriage is that Marriage occurs in every culture in some form, but its exact characteristics vary widely.
